Digital Recordkeeping and Data Security for Building Safety
This workshop shows how to manage building safety information securely in the digital world. It covers what data forms part of the Golden Thread, how to store it safely, and how to meet privacy and security requirements under ISO 27001 and UK GDPR.
What you will learn
- What building safety data must be kept and shared
- How to store and transfer information securely
- Basics of ISO 27001 and GDPR for safety data
- How to protect photos, videos, and reports in cloud systems
- How to prove data integrity to regulators or clients
